a scale drawing for a restaurant is shown below. in the drawing, 3 cm represents 4 m. assuming the dining hall is rectangular, find the area of the real dining hall.
Step1: Find the real - length of the dining hall
Given that 3 cm represents 4 m. The length of the dining hall in the drawing is 9 cm. Let the real - length be $l$. We set up a proportion: $\frac{3}{4}=\frac{9}{l}$. Cross - multiplying gives $3l = 4\times9$, so $l=\frac{4\times9}{3}=12$ m.
Step2: Find the real - width of the dining hall
The width of the dining hall in the drawing is 3 cm. Let the real - width be $w$. Using the proportion $\frac{3}{4}=\frac{3}{w}$, cross - multiplying gives $3w = 4\times3$, so $w = 4$ m.
Step3: Calculate the area of the dining hall
The area of a rectangle is $A=l\times w$. Substituting $l = 12$ m and $w = 4$ m, we get $A=12\times4 = 48$ m².
